Suriya: Rs 100 Crore Fee After Rs 300 Crore Hit. The actor has reportedly decided to charge a staggering Rs 100 crore as his remuneration following the massive success of his recent film Karuppu. This fantasy action drama, directed by RJ Balaji, earned over Rs 300 crore at the box office, marking a major comeback for Suriya during a challenging phase in his career. Industry buzz suggests that Suriya will command this three-digit fee starting from his 49th project.

Karuppu’s phenomenal performance gave Suriya a new lease of life in Kollywood, and the actor now appears ready to leverage his successful streak. The fee hike positions him among the highest-paid stars in the south Indian film industry.
Suriya’s next release is Viswanath & Sons, directed by Lucky Baskhar fame Venky Atluri. The film, produced by Naga Vamsi, is scheduled to hit theaters on August 14.
